Today’s story… #6: 2020 Olympic Field of Six… We knew a year ago who two of the six teams slotted to play in the 2020 Tokyo Olympic Games were as Japan was automatically in as the host team and the United States had qualified by winning the 2018 WBSC Softball World Championship. Four spots, however, were still left undetermined before this year’s qualifiers across the world determined who would try to take down the favored Power 2 of Japan and the US…

It has been 12 years since softball was last played in the Olympics and those 20208 Beijing Games came down to the two teams considered the favorites for the 2020 Tokyo Games—Japan and the United States.

Team Japan upset the USA squad, which had won the Gold Medals in the previous three Olympics (Atlanta in ’96, Sydney in ’00 and Athens in ’04), to end the American’s 22-game win streak.

Team USA after winning the 2018 WSBC World Championship with a 7-6 walk-off single over Japan. Photo by USA Softball.

Ironically, Japan would become the host for the 2020 games and the Tokyo Games meant that the host city would already be one of the six teams determined to compete in what will be a format of single round-robin play preceding the bronze and gold medal games totaling 17 games.

After the United States qualified in 2018 by winning the WSBC World Championship (see below), that meant the four remaining teams would come from three international tournaments: one from competitions in Asia/Oceania and Europe/Africa and two entrants from a tournament in the Americas.

By the end of September, we knew who the field of would be—Japan, USA, Italy, Mexico, Canada and Australia—and how they got there.
